How to Select a Convertible Sectional Sofa

A sectional sofa is a great addition to any living space. It can accommodate several people and provide comfortable seating for family gatherings and friends. It is available in different designs and colors.

Choose a neutral color that will blend in with your existing furniture. Choose a sofa with soft, cozy cushions that are easy to clean.

1. The Size

A sectional sofa can provide a more comfortable seating space for several people than traditional sofas. They also offer more flexibility when it comes to the layout options. They come in a variety of sizes, ranging from small two-piece sets, to large six-piece ones. A lot of them come with additional elements such as storage space and recliners.

Before you purchase a sectional, it's crucial to understand the dimensions of the sofa and how it will fit in your living room. If the sofa is too large, it can overwhelm your space and make it feel cramped and crowded. On the other side, a sectional that is too small won't provide enough seating for all the members of your family.

There are a myriad of styles of sectional sofas that are available on the market. It's important to choose one that complements your home decor while meeting your seating needs. Take into consideration the kind of fabric that will be used for the cushions and the filling. Certain types of fabric are easier to wash than others, so it's important to choose a stain-resistant option if you have pets or children.

You should also think about whether you would like your sofa to convert into the mattress. Certain models can be converted into a queen-sized bed which is ideal when hosting guests. Other features include USB ports, movable headseats, and massage components. Also, be sure to choose a sofa that is easy to set up and maintain.

4. The Function

When looking for a convertible sofa sectional, it is important to determine if the product meets your functional requirements. If you have children or pets, you may want an item that is easy to clean and stain-resistant. This will help you keep it looking great for longer, and it is also a great fit to your lifestyle.

Another factor to consider is how many people you intend to seat on the couch, since this will impact the number of seats and the configurations you require. You might also want to consider a sectional sofa that includes a chaise, as it will provide you with more seating options. Some sectionals come with a fixed chaise that can't be changed from left to right, and others have an reversible chaise that can be moved to either side of the sofa.

If you're planning to move in the near future, a modular sectional sofa is a great option. These sofas can be disassembled easily and transported to your new home. It is not necessary to hire professional movers.
